The sequel outlasted the Jeff Bridges and Matt Damon western True Grit, which finished No. 2 for the second straight weekend with $24.5 million.

Bridges also had the No. 3 film with Disney’s sci-fi reboot Tron: Legacy at $18.3 million, while Dan Aykroyd’s Yogi Bear finished fourth with $13 million.

The Chronicles of Narnia: The Voyage of the Dawn Treader rounded out the weekend top five at $10.5 million.

Weekend Box Office: December 31, 2010 to January 2, 2011:

1. Little Fockers, $26.3 million.

2. True Grit, $24.5 million.

3. Tron: Legacy, $18.3 million.

4. Yogi Bear, $13 million.

5. The Chronicles of Narnia: The Voyage of the Dawn Treader, $10.5 million.

6. Tangled, $10.01 million.

7. The Fighter, $10 million.

8. Gulliver’s Travels, $9.1 million.

9. Black Swan, $8.5 million.

10. The King’s Speech, $7.6 million.
